Safe Browsing Habits You Should Adopt Right Now

As you surf the web, whether it's to check your email or shop for a new pair of shoes, security should be at the forefront of your mind. In today’s digital age where hackers and cybercriminals lurk around every virtual corner, adopting safe browsing habits ensures that your personal information is secure online.

Here are some prudent methods you can adopt right now:

1. Regularly Update Your Browser

Keeping your browser updated is an integral part of maintaining a secure surfing environment. Regular updates not only improve user experience by fixing bugs and introducing new features but also fix any identified security vulnerabilities inherent in previous versions.

Ensure that automatic updates are enabled on your browser - this way, you don't need to worry about manually updating them regularly.

2. Use Strong Passwords

Passwords serve as the first line of defense against unauthorized access to your account, and weak passwords simply make it easy for hackers to break through.

Using strong combinations which include symbols, numbers along with uppercase and lowercase letters significantly toughens the password barrier. Also, avoid using easily guessable details like date of birth or names; these are prime targets for cyber attackers who use social engineering techniques.

Applying unique passwords across different sites helps prevent a domino effect if one account gets compromised - the other accounts remain untouched since they have distinct authentication details.

4. Avoid Clicking Suspicious Links

One click can sometimes be all it takes to compromise your data security. Hackers commonly employ 'phishing' methods where they disguise malicious links as innocent-looking emails, messages or pop-up windows; clicking these leads you to fake websites designed solely for stealing your information.

Double-check the URL of a website before entering any sensitive data - scammers often use URLs that look almost like those of legitimate sites but have subtle misspellings.

5. Install Security-Enhancing Extensions

Certain browser extensions can enhance online privacy and protection against malicious websites.

Extensions such as HTTPS Everywhere ensure encryption on web pages thus protecting data transmission between the site and user. Others like Privacy Badger offer automatic blocking services against tracking cookies providing an additional safeguard layer promoting secure browsing practices.

Always download from official stores due to higher quality control measures reducing chances of rogue software entering circulation through these platforms.
